For Employees
All employees are eligible to use OrbisPay services once their employer is enrolled in our program. However, your employer can control who uses the service.
Once you are signed up with the OrbisPay app, you will be able to view all accessible earnings. You can just work your shifts as usual and then head over to our app anytime to view and access any/all available earnings to you.
By default, all employees can access up to 50% or $500 of their earnings each pay period. The employer can also determine the maximum accessible amount.
Yes. All employees must link at least one bank account AND a debit card so we can transfer your accessible earnings.
Not at all. Since OrbisPay is not a lending provider, your credit score is not a determining factor to use our services.
Money will be deposited instantly to your debit card if you choose the Instant Transfer option, whereas, for Bank Transfers (ACH), it takes 2 business days.
For Companies
We do. OrbisPay fronts the funds to employees. There is no income or expense impact for the employer.
It is completely free. There are no setup or recurring costs for employers. Employees are charged minimal transaction fees; however, some employers choose to sponsor this cost and offer the services for free to their employees.
We only require employee name, employee ID, and clock-in clock-out information. We are constantly monitoring, auditing, and improving our security systems and adding to our list of certifications to ensure that your data and your employees’ data are safe and secure.
OrbisPay customer support is available to all employees through our mobile app or customer support hotline. We handle customer support in-house, so you can be sure there is always a person ready to assist your employees. This service is available in English and Spanish.
Once the employer is on contract, a file-exchange pathway is determined via SFTP or API integration. OrbisPay is compatible with most payroll and time and attendance systems.
Yes, OrbisPay works for salaried and hourly workers in the same way.
